Hydrangea Sundae Fraise

5 from 1 customers

Hydrangea Sundae Fraise is a beautiful variety that features large and showy, cone-shaped flower heads that begin as white and age to light pink. This gives a dual colouring to the flowers which are borne from summer through autumn and complemented with dark green foliage. It grows as a multi-stemmed, deciduous shrub with a rounded form to about 1.5 m tall and the same wide but can be trimmed as necessary. Hydrangea Sundae Fraise is a great variety for adding to a mixed planting, maintaining in a container, including in a cottage garden, or for planting around an outdoor living area.

What does the Sundae Fraise Hydrangea need to grow well?

The Sundae Fraise Hydrangea grows best when positioned in full sun or partial shade on a well-drained soil that is slightly acidic. It is tolerant of frost, cool climates, coastal environments, and humid climates. Wind protection is important to ensure branches are not snapped and this will also result in a better formed plant that will flower more prolifically.

what size pot to place in for our deck Hydrangea Sundae Fraise?

The pot size should be able to hold at least 45 L of potting mix. Therefore a minimum size would be 450 mm wide by 450 mm tall.
